The Minnesota Film Alliance (MFA) is a state-wide non-profit trade association that represents Minnesota’s film, episodic & digital content production industry.

With the establishment of Explore Minnesota Film and the office finally operational, the Minnesota Film Alliance is restructuring to face the new landscape of film production in Minnesota.

Production in Minnesota Is A Driver of Economic Activity...But We Need A Strong and Sustainable Tax Policy That Helps Us Compete With Other States Offering Incentives To Attract Projects

 

With the 2023 passage of the Film Tax Incentive program, we are now in a position to convince production to return to Minnesota. But to be truly competitive and benefit from the economic development that results from content production, we need to strengthen our incentive by lowering the spending cap and increasing the crew credit from 25% to %35, to provide a robust and sustainable business environment for the production industry.
